About A. Bruni

A. Bruni is a scholar working on Molecular Biology, Plant Science, Immunology, Ecology, Evolution, Behavior and Systematics and Physiology, having authored 183 papers that have together received 3.2k indexed citations. Recurring topics across this work include Lipid Membrane Structure and Behavior (27 papers), ATP Synthase and ATPases Research (21 papers), Sphingolipid Metabolism and Signaling (19 papers), Mitochondrial Function and Pathology (15 papers), Phagocytosis and Immune Regulation (14 papers), Metabolism and Genetic Disorders (11 papers), Advanced Authentication Protocols Security (10 papers) and Erythrocyte Function and Pathophysiology (10 papers). The work is most often cited by research in Clinical Biochemistry (187 citations), Molecular Biology (1.7k citations), Biochemistry (160 citations), Immunology (323 citations) and Cell Biology (248 citations). A. Bruni has collaborated with scholars based in Italy, Denmark and United States. Frequent co-authors include G. Toffano, A.R. Contessa, Sisto Luciani, E. Boarato, E. Bigon, Ferruccio Poli, Pietro Palatini, A. Léon, Carlo Romagnoli and B. Tosi. Their work appears in journals such as Biochimica et Biophysica Acta (BBA) - Molecular Cell Research, Biochimica et Biophysica Acta (BBA) - Biomembranes, Biochimica et Biophysica Acta (BBA) - Bioenergetics, Inflammation Research and British Journal of Pharmacology.
